In a world where globalization is paramount, bilingual management education is emerging as a critical factor for success in various sectors. Countries in Southeast Asia, particularly Indonesia, are recognizing the importance of equipping future leaders with diverse language skills that meet international business demands. Courses that combine language proficiency with management theories provide students a unique advantage, allowing them to navigate complex business environments more effectively.
The demand for bilingual professionals has skyrocketed in recent years. As businesses expand their reach, there is a pressing need for individuals who can communicate effectively across cultural and linguistic barriers. This trend is especially pronounced in the ASEAN region, where countries like Indonesia are becoming key players in the global economy. Despite the clear benefits, several challenges remain in rolling out effective bilingual management education. Limited resources, lack of trained educators, and varying levels of governmental support can hinder program implementation. Moreover, the cultural significance of language often complicates educational landscapes, where communities might favor native languages over English or other foreign languages.
Recent initiatives are showcasing innovative methods to address these challenges. For example, institutions are increasingly leveraging technology to deliver bilingual courses. Technology plays a pivotal role in facilitating bilingual education. Tools such as AI-driven platforms, virtual classrooms, and interactive learning modules provide learners with rich educational experiences that transcend traditional boundaries. In Indonesia, the rise of tech-enabled learning solutions is pivotal in addressing educational disparities, particularly in rural areas where access to resources may be limited.
